Introduction

If you're serious about strength training, a barbell jack is an essential tool in your arsenal. This handy device allows you to lift the barbell slightly off the ground, making it easier to add or remove weights without straining your back or risking injury. With a barbell jack, you can focus on your workout, knowing that you have a reliable tool to help you manage your weights effectively.

Here are some key benefits of using a barbell jack:
  • Safety: Prevents injuries by allowing you to lift the barbell safely.
  • Efficiency: Saves time when switching weights during your workout.
  • Versatility: Suitable for various types of weightlifting exercises.

FAQs

Look for a barbell jack that is sturdy, easy to use, and compatible with the weight plates you own. Consider the weight capacity and whether it can accommodate different bar sizes.

Key features include a durable construction, non-slip base, easy-to-use mechanism, and portability for convenient storage.

Many people overlook the weight capacity and compatibility with their existing equipment, leading to poor performance or safety issues.

Most barbell jacks are designed to work with standard Olympic barbells, but it's important to check compatibility with your specific barbell type.

Regularly inspect your barbell jack for wear and tear, clean it after use, and store it in a dry place to prolong its lifespan.
